Support-Specific Priorities vs. General Buying Criteria
Support teams must weigh criteria like conversation routing, agent collaboration, and 24/7 reliability far more heavily than general buyers who might focus on cost or ease of setup alone. A general buyer may admire a visual bot builder, while a support lead needs granular conversation assignment and real-time collaboration inside a shared team inbox.
That difference shapes every part of platform evaluation. Support leaders should map each criterion back to daily workflows and pain points rather than comparing feature checklists in the abstract.
Start by listing the moments that break down most often. Common support-specific priorities include:
- Shared team inbox with conversation routing so no customer message sits unassigned
- Automation with human handoff, so bots handle routine questions and agents step in when nuance is required
- SLA adherence tracked through message delivery status, read receipts, and delivery reports
- Helpdesk software and CRM integration so tickets, history, and customer records stay in one place
- Message template management, including template approval workflows and clarity on the 24-hour customer service window
A platform's technical foundation matters here too. Teams should ask whether it exposes a REST API, webhook, callback URL, or API endpoint that lets their ticketing system receive events automatically. Developer documentation quality and a sandbox environment for testing are practical signals of how smoothly API integration will go.
The distinction between session messaging and business-initiated messages also affects support design. Customer-initiated conversations flow freely within the service window, while business-initiated messages depend on approved templates. Platforms that make this boundary confusing create compliance risk and frustrated agents.

Unified Team Inbox and Agent Collaboration
A unified team inbox consolidates conversations from WhatsApp, Facebook Messenger, Instagram DM, and web widgets into a single interface, enabling agents to collaborate without switching tabs. This is the foundation of any serious omnichannel support operation.
Without a shared team inbox, agents work in silos. Messages get answered twice, or worse, not at all. A unified view solves this by giving every agent visibility into the full conversation queue.
Look for specific collaboration features during your platform evaluation:
- Conversation assignment so each chat has a clear owner
- Internal notes that let agents discuss a case without the customer seeing it
- Collision detection that warns when two agents open the same chat
- Mentions and tagging so an agent can pull in a colleague for help
- Reassignment based on expertise, language, or workload
Conversation routing rules matter just as much. Round-robin distribution keeps workloads even. Skill-based routing sends technical questions to technical agents. Both reduce response times and prevent the "who's handling this?" problem that plagues growing teams.
The payoff is measurable in operational terms: no lost messages, faster first responses, and clear accountability when something goes wrong. Automation, Chatbot, and Human Handoff Quality
Effective automation goes beyond basic chatbots; it requires seamless human handoff when conversations become complex or emotional. The handoff is where most platforms fail, and it is exactly where customer trust is won or lost.
A well-built chatbot handles predictable work: answering FAQs, tracking orders, qualifying leads, and collecting payments. These are high-volume, low-complexity tasks that free human agents for harder problems.
But automation must know its limits. The bot should transfer to a human when:
- The user explicitly asks for a person
- Sentiment analysis flags frustration or anger
- The query falls outside the bot's trained scope
- The conversation involves a complaint, refund, or escalation
Handoff quality depends on three mechanisms. Context transfer ensures the human agent sees the full chat history, so the customer never repeats themselves. Priority routing pushes frustrated customers to the front of the queue. Notifications alert available agents immediately rather than leaving the customer waiting.
Poor handoff looks like this: the bot asks for an order number, then the human agent asks for it again. Or the customer explains their issue twice. Each repetition erodes satisfaction. Best practice is to pass everything forward automatically.
Bots also improve with training. Feeding real conversation data back into the system helps it recognize new intents and edge cases over time. CRM, Helpdesk, and Ecommerce Integrations
Integrations with CRM, helpdesk, and ecommerce platforms allow support teams to access customer data and order history directly within the WhatsApp conversation. Without them, agents toggle between tools, and every toggle costs time.
There are three integration categories worth prioritizing in your platform evaluation:
- CRM systems such as Salesforce or HubSpot, for customer profiles and interaction history
- Helpdesk software such as Zendesk or Freshdesk, for the ticketing system and case management
- Ecommerce platforms such as Shopify or WooCommerce, for order status and fulfillment details
When these connect properly, the agent experience changes completely. A support rep can see that a customer has three prior tickets, check whether an order shipped, and update the ticket status, all from the chat window. No copy-pasting order numbers. No asking the customer to hold while they check another system.
Practical examples show the value. An agent can trigger a refund in Shopify without leaving the inbox. A ticket in Zendesk can be updated or closed from the conversation view. The customer gets a faster answer, and the agent handles more conversations per shift.
For custom needs, evaluate the platform's API and webhook capabilities. A REST API, SDK, and clear developer documentation let your engineering team build connections to internal systems. Webhooks and callback URLs push events in real time, so your tools stay in sync with what happens in the chat.

Meta Business Partner Verification and WABA Status
Verifying that a platform is an official Meta Business Partner ensures you get reliable API access, compliance with WhatsApp policies, and priority support. Partner status is not a marketing label. It reflects a direct working relationship with Meta that affects how your account behaves.
Platforms with this status typically offer higher messaging limits and faster template approval turnaround, both of which shape how quickly your team can launch new customer communication flows. They also tend to resolve policy issues more efficiently when account problems arise.
Checking partner status is straightforward. Meta maintains a public partner directory, and any credible vendor should be listed there. Ask the vendor for their WhatsApp Business Account (WABA) status as well. A healthy WABA carries a good quality rating, which influences message delivery and how many business-initiated messages you can send.
Unofficial providers often resell access through intermediaries. That setup can lead to sudden message delays, template rejections, or outright account bans when Meta flags policy violations. For customer support teams, an unexpected ban means losing the channel entirely, often without warning.
When evaluating WhatsApp Business API platforms, request documentation of partner status and WABA quality in writing. This step protects your team from disruptions that are difficult to reverse once they occur.
Data Encryption, Privacy, and Regional Requirements
End-to-end encryption and compliance with regional data protection laws (like GDPR, HIPAA, or India's DPDP Act) are essential for protecting customer conversations. Support teams handle order details, account information, and personal identifiers daily, so encryption is a baseline requirement, not a bonus feature.
Look for TLS encryption for data in transit and AES-256 encryption at rest. Together, these standards protect messages moving between your systems and any data stored on the vendor's infrastructure. Enterprise and government clients in particular expect both.
Privacy controls matter just as much. Ask about data retention policies, how user consent is managed, and whether the platform provides audit logs for tracking access. These features support accountability during internal reviews or regulatory inquiries.
Regional requirements add another layer. Some jurisdictions require data residency within their borders, and certifications such as SOC 2 or ISO 27001 signal that a vendor follows recognized security practices. Conversation Markups, Per-Seat Fees, and Add-Ons
Many platforms add a markup on top of WhatsApp's conversation fees, charge per agent seat, and require additional payments for features like extra channels or API calls. Breaking these components apart makes comparison far easier.
WhatsApp itself charges conversation fees that vary by message category and country. Marketing conversations typically cost more than utility or service ones. On top of that base rate, providers often apply a platform markup, though this varies by vendor.
Per-seat pricing is the other major line item. Vendors frequently charge a recurring fee per agent per month, so a growing support team pays more even when message volume stays flat. Add-ons then stack on top.
- Extra social channels beyond WhatsApp
- External actions or API calls that trigger workflows
- Bot building tools for automated responses
- Additional agent seats as the team expands

Message Volume Limits and Delivery Performance
Platforms impose message volume limits based on your WABA quality rating and tier, so you must assess whether they can handle your peak loads without throttling. WhatsApp typically starts businesses at a lower daily limit and raises it as messaging quality stays healthy.
Common tiers move through daily caps such as 1,000, 10,000, and 100,000 messages, with higher or unlimited tiers available to businesses that maintain good quality ratings. A platform that cannot help you grow through these tiers will eventually bottleneck your customer communication.
Delivery performance deserves equal scrutiny. Track three metrics closely:
- Delivery rate: the share of sent messages that actually reach the recipient
- Read rate: how often customers open your messages
- Latency: the time between sending and delivery
Configure your webhook and callback URL to capture message delivery status and failed message events. Failed deliveries often signal template rejections, invalid numbers, or quality issues that need fast attention. Regular reviews of delivery reports help teams catch problems before customers notice them.
For critical notifications such as appointment reminders or service alerts, consider a fallback channel like SMS or email. If WhatsApp delivery fails, the message still reaches the customer through omnichannel support flows.

Building the Evaluation Scorecard and Running a Pilot
A structured scorecard and a real-world pilot are the most reliable ways to compare platforms and predict long-term success. Vendor demos tend to look similar, and pricing pages rarely capture the full picture. A scorecard forces the team to agree on what matters before conversations begin, while a pilot proves how a platform behaves once real customer conversations start flowing through it.
The scorecard also protects the decision from bias. When every WhatsApp Business API platform is judged against the same weighted criteria, the strongest fit usually becomes obvious. The steps below show how to build that scorecard and then validate the leading candidate in a controlled pilot.
Step 1: Define the criteria and assign weights. Start with the categories that matter most to a customer support team. Common choices include compliance and template approval handling, CRM integration and helpdesk software fit, pricing structure, scalability, developer documentation, and the quality of the agent inbox.
Weights should reflect business priorities. If the team handles high message volumes, reliability and conversation routing might carry more weight than a lower per-message price. A simple weighting scale from 1 to 5 works well, where 5 marks a must-have category and 1 marks a nice-to-have.
Step 2: Score each vendor on a 1-5 scale. For every criterion, rate how well the platform meets the team's needs. A 5 means the requirement is fully met with room to grow. A 1 means the platform cannot support the requirement or would need significant workarounds.
Score consistently across vendors. If one platform earns a 4 for CRM integration, the same evidence standard should apply to every other candidate. Document the reason behind each score so the team can revisit decisions later.
Step 3: Calculate weighted totals. Multiply each score by its weight and add the results. A sample table shows how this works in practice.
| Criterion | Weight | Vendor A Score | Weighted Total |
|---|---|---|---|
| Compliance and template approval | 5 | 4 | 20 |
| CRM integration | 4 | 5 | 20 |
| Pricing structure | 3 | 3 | 9 |
| Scalability | 4 | 4 | 16 |
| Developer documentation | 2 | 5 | 10 |
The weighted total gives a clear ranking, but it should guide discussion rather than replace it. A platform that scores slightly lower overall may still win if it excels in a category the team cannot compromise on.
Step 4: Run a pilot with defined success metrics. Pick the top one or two vendors and test them with real workflows. Choose metrics before the pilot starts so results are easy to interpret.
- Average response time and first-response time
- CSAT scores from customer-initiated conversations
- Template approval turnaround and rejection rates
- Message delivery status accuracy and read receipts
- Agent effort when using the shared team inbox
Select a small team for the pilot, ideally three to five agents who handle a representative mix of queries. Run the pilot for two to four weeks so the group experiences normal volume fluctuations, including the 24-hour customer service window and any business-initiated messages.
During the pilot, watch how the platform handles conversation routing, webhook reliability, and message delivery status updates. These details rarely surface in a demo but quickly become visible under daily use. Agents should log friction points as they happen rather than relying on memory at the end.
Gather feedback in two ways: quantitative metrics from the dashboard and qualitative input from agents. A short survey at the midpoint and a longer debrief at the close usually capture both. Compare the pilot results against the scorecard predictions. If a platform underperforms on a heavily weighted criterion, that gap matters more than a strong showing elsewhere.
